So. I'm 37 years old and have never ridden before. I got the bug a while back, took an MSF course and am looking to buy my first bike. Since I'm a little older, and am 6'2, 195 lbs, I've decided to ignore every article I read about beginner bikes (pretty dumb, I know) and get a bigger bike. I have it narrowed down to two bikes, now I'm having the classic heart vs head argument.
I rode the America and loved it. It's the top of the heap as far as I'm concerned. Not intimidating, good handling, and I hear from quite a few people that it makes a good first bike.
I rode a Kawasaki Vulcan 900, and against my initial prejudice (since it's really trying to look like a Harley) I really liked it. It fit me well and again wasn't intimidating.
My debate now comes down to this. The vulcan is $1200 cheaper, has fuel injection and belt drive. There are even a few other niceties like a fuel guage. My head is telling me to buy this one.
The America is more expensive, but I could see myself volunteering to take out the garbage just to look at it in the garage. However, everyone says you either drop or lay down your first bike, and I think I'd cry since the America is such a thing of beauty. My heart is telling me to buy this one.
I know the replies to my quandry will be pretty one sided here, but I'd like to hear your opinions, especially concerning the belt vs chain drive and EFI. Any sound advice anybody could give would be greatly appreciated.
